Bruce Conner: Lithographs
Image

Main Gallery Corridor, February 13 – May 8, 2025
With this group of lithograph prints, artist Bruce Conner (1933-2008) intentionally preserved a series of highly detailed but fading images he originally produced using felt-tip pens in the early 1970s. The nine prints on display explore the act of perception by prompting prolonged, up-close viewing. The meticulous black and white compositions recall mandala forms as well as microscopic imagery. The selected prints on view are part of the Museum’s permanent collection.
